A look at the Max pump pro 2 from Flextailgear.. this is the tiny pumps bigger brother.
I have a tiny pump which is great, however I cannot inflate a kayak.. so I have got the max pump 2 pro to try out and see if a small hand held pump can blow up an inflatable Kayak.
